Devil's advocate here for the Vista! We went in completely sure we were going to get the Cruz because we thought it was a little absurd to buy a giant stroller for a kid we didn't even have yet, but the Vista V3 and the Cruz V3 are functionally the exact same size and weight, the Vista is just more adaptable. We'd love to have a second kid fairly close to the first, so it didn't end up making sense for us to buy two $900 strollers two years apart, especially when they were so similar. I liked how sturdy the wheels felt on the Vista compared to the slightly smaller strollers and it was just as easy to fold. The Cruz doesn't feel super heavy to me and out of curiosity I googled to see if it's heavier than the smaller Nunas. The Cruz is 27.6 lbs and the Nuna Mixx is 28.3 lbs. If you can, I'd recommend going to a baby store and trying them out, but to me the advantages of the Cruz outweighed the convenience of a smaller stroller, especially when the margins were coming down to less than 2-3 inches and the weights were the same.

No, I bought and sold a Vista V3 within 6 months of having my baby, coming from someone that went stroller crazy and bought 4 different strollers to try out. Yes it’s smooth as heck but so are other high end strollers. It’s bulky and having the smaller baby on the bottom is so awkward. It’s not as compatible with other car seats beside their uppababy line without buying a bunch of off market add ons. I would get the Cybex Gazelle for better configuration or splurge on the Bugaboo Donkey Duo if you have space and funds.

I got the Vista and sold it, one good thing about an Uppababy product especially the Vista is that it holds up its value pretty well. I sold it for $100 less than I bought it from with 4 months of use. I soon realize that my baby doesn’t like to be restrained in a stroller so hauling 2 kids with the Vista wouldn’t work for us but a single stroller with the piggy back board would work perfectly. I ended up buying another high end single stroller called Joolz Hub2 and liking it so far. I really enjoy the smooth ride and I do notice the difference in build and ride quality between a Joolz/Nuna/ Bugaboo/Uppababy/ Cybex I’ve tried in store vs the one Graco sold at Costco.
